Pursuant to the Texas Public Information Act, I hereby request the following records:

I, Parker Embry of Houston, TX, am hereby requesting all case documents and trial transcripts for prisoner Rodney Reed of Bastrop County Texas. Reed, a current inmate on Texas Death Row, was convicted of the 1996 murder of Stacey Stites. His execution has been stayed indefinitely by the Texas Court of Criminal Appeals. His case documents and the trial transcripts would prove beneficial to my research on execution proceedings and the appeal process in the state of Texas. Please allow me to view the prisoner's file and trial transcripts. Any other documents pertaining to his record while incarcerated and in police custody would also prove beneficial.

The requested documents will be made available to the general public, and this request is not being made for commercial purposes.

In the event that there are fees, I would be grateful if you would inform me of the total charges in advance of fulfilling my request. I would prefer the request filled electronically, by e-mail attachment if available or CD-ROM if not.

Thank you in advance for your anticipated cooperation in this matter. I look forward to receiving your response to this request within 10 business days, as the statute requires.

Mr. Embry,

This office is currently reviewing your below request. I have attached the cost estimate associated with the responsive information. However, we believe some of the responsive information contains medical information that is confidential under HIPAA and therefore cannot be released. Please let me know if you agree to receive only the basic, non-confidential information that is associated with the attached cost estimate. Otherwise, we will send the responsive information to the Office of the Attorney General to request a ruling as to whether it can be released, which can result in a waiting period of up to 55 days.
